Protokol MCP memberdayakan model bahasa besar, membuka era interaksi Web3 yang baru.

robot
Pembuatan abstrak sedang berlangsung

Protokol MCP memberdayakan model bahasa besar untuk kemampuan interaksi Web3

MCP(Model-Context Protokol) adalah protokol terbuka yang muncul, dirancang untuk menyediakan cara akses alat dan layanan eksternal yang terstandarisasi untuk model bahasa besar. Berbeda dengan sistem plugin tradisional, MCP mengadopsi arsitektur klien-server, memungkinkan integrasi yang mulus antara model dan sistem eksternal melalui antarmuka protokol yang seragam.

Web3 Pemula Series: MCP Selesaikan Transaksi Dalam Satu Kalimat!

Keunggulan utama MCP meliputi:

  1. Antarmuka yang distandarisasi: protokol yang seragam mencegah pengembangan solusi integrasi yang berulang.

  2. Keamanan: Kontrol izin yang ketat dan mekanisme sandbox memastikan akses aman dari alat eksternal.

  3. Skalabilitas: mendukung berbagai jenis alat dari panggilan API sederhana hingga pemrosesan data yang kompleks.

  4. Interoperabilitas: Klien yang mendukung MCP dapat menggunakan layanan yang kompatibel untuk mencapai kompatibilitas lintas platform.

Web3 Pemula Seri: MCP Selesaikan Transaksi dalam Satu Kalimat!

Di bidang Web3, MCP dapat memberikan kemampuan interaksi blockchain yang kaya untuk model bahasa besar, termasuk:

  • Cek Aset: Periksa saldo token, riwayat transaksi, dll.
  • Operasi di blockchain: mengirim transaksi, menyebarkan dan memanggil kontrak pintar
  • Integrasi DeFi: Berinteraksi dengan bursa terdesentralisasi, protokol peminjaman, dan aplikasi DeFi lainnya
  • Operasi lintas rantai: mendukung manajemen aset multirantai dan transfer lintas rantai
  • Manajemen NFT: Mencari, mentransfer, dan memperdagangkan aset NFT

Web3 Pemula Seri: MCP Selesaikan Transaksi Dalam Satu Kalimat!

Berikut akan dibangun sebuah layanan Web3 MCP sederhana menggunakan Node.js dan TypeScript, yang menunjukkan cara kerja MCP dan praktik terbaik.

Membuat Proyek

  1. Buat folder proyek dan inisialisasi

  2. Pasang paket dependensi yang diperlukan

  3. Tambahkan konfigurasi TypeScript

  4. Ubah konfigurasi package.json

Web3 Pemula Seri: MCP Satu Kalimat Selesai Transaksi!

Menulis Server MCP

Sebagai contoh fungsi getBalance di jaringan uji Sepolia:

  1. Daftar layanan node, dapatkan URL RPC, instansikan penyedia

  2. Menulis logika alat

  3. Mulai layanan dan tambahkan penanganan kesalahan

Web3 Pemula Seri: MCP Selesaikan Transaksi dalam Satu Kalimat!

Dengan ini, layanan MCP dasar telah selesai.

Layanan Debugging

Mengemas produk JavaScript, menjalankan modelcontextprotokol/inspector untuk debugging.

Web3 Pemula Seri: MCP Selesaikan Transaksi Dalam Satu Kalimat!

Menyempurnakan fungsi dan mengintegrasikannya ke Cursor

  1. Menambahkan lebih banyak fitur, seperti dukungan multi-chain, pencarian gas, pengiriman transaksi, pencarian informasi token, dll.

  2. Mengacu pada Cursor setelah dikemas. Cursor adalah IDE pintar yang mengintegrasikan teknologi AI, dibangun di atas VSCode, dan mendukung integrasi MC.

Web3 Pemula Seri: MCP Selesaikan Transaksi dalam Satu Kalimat!

Contoh Penggunaan

Dalam fitur chat Cursor, Anda dapat berinteraksi dengan kode menggunakan bahasa alami:

  • Cek saldo alamat: "Cek saldo alamat 0xE21E97Ad8B527acb90F0b148EfaFbA46625382cE di Sepolia"

Seri Pemula Web3: MCP Selesaikan Transaksi dalam Satu Kalimat!

  • Kirim transaksi:"Kirim 0.1ETH ke alamat ini 0x2c1d9ef7ccede70d77e6038701cd63138dd920a0"

Web3 pemula seri: MCP satu kalimat menyelesaikan transaksi!

Web3 Pemula Series: MCP Selesaikan Transaksi Dalam Satu Kalimat!

Web3 Pemula Seri: MCP Selesaikan Transaksi dalam Satu Kalimat!

Web3 Pemula Series: MCP Selesaikan Transaksi dalam Satu Kalimat!

Web3 Pemula Seri: MCP Selesaikan Transaksi dalam Satu Kalimat!

Prospek Masa Depan

Kombinasi MCP dan Web3 membuka dunia baru yang penuh kemungkinan bagi kita. Di masa depan, dapat diperluas lebih lanjut:

  • Mendukung lebih banyak blockchain ( seperti Bitcoin, Solana, Tron, dan lain-lain )
  • Mengintegrasikan fungsi lintas rantai, mewujudkan konversi aset antar berbagai rantai
  • Integrasi mendalam protokol DeFi dan operasi pasar NFT

Melalui percakapan sederhana, operasi blockchain yang kompleks dapat dilakukan, MCP sedang merombak cara kita berinteraksi dengan dunia Web3.

Web3 Pemula Series: MCP Selesaikan Transaksi dalam Satu Kalimat!

Lihat Asli
Halaman ini mungkin berisi konten pihak ketiga, yang disediakan untuk tujuan informasi saja (bukan pernyataan/jaminan) dan tidak boleh dianggap sebagai dukungan terhadap pandangannya oleh Gate, atau sebagai nasihat keuangan atau profesional. Lihat Penafian untuk detailnya.
  • Hadiah
  • 3
  • Bagikan
Komentar
0/400
0xLuckboxvip
· 6jam yang lalu
Ngomong apa sih, Alamat dompetnya saja tidak ada.
Lihat AsliBalas0
AirdropworkerZhangvip
· 6jam yang lalu
Standarisasi semua adalah harimau kertas, bisa mengatur apa saja.
Lihat AsliBalas0
SilentObservervip
· 6jam yang lalu
protokol begitu banyak, datang lagi satu sigh
Lihat AsliBalas0
  • Sematkan
Perdagangkan Kripto Di Mana Saja Kapan Saja
qrCode
Pindai untuk mengunduh aplikasi Gate
Komunitas
Bahasa Indonesia
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)